Former Harlan County High School runners Sean Cooper, Josh Lee and Alex Lewis helped lead Alice Lloyd to a race win on Saturday in Indiana.

It was just like old times for three members of the Alice Lloyd cross county team on Saturday.
Former Harlan County High School runners Alex Lewis, Joshua Lee and Sean Cooper helped lead Alice Lloyd to the team title on Saturday in the IU East Invitational in Richmond, Indiana. Lewis was third overall with a time of 28:42. Lee was 11th at 31:00 and Cooper was 32nd at 35:55.
“What a great experience for these guys. I have such a sense of pride in them for all they’re doing. I’m always on pins and needles waiting on the texts to roll in letting me know how it went,” Harlan County coach Ryan Vitatoe said. “Coach (Brandon) Arnold has that program rolling along, and I’m so thankful my guys are part of it.”
The victory was especially sweet for Lee, who took a year off from running to attend Southeast Kentucky Community and Technical College.
“It’s great to be back into it and running with the same group of guys,” Lee said.
The race was hosted by Eastern Indiana University.
The Alice Lloyd squad will return to action on Saturday in Rio Grande, Ohio.
